The cheapest way to get from Downey to Morongo Casino, Resort & Spa is to line 460 bus and bus via San Bernardino which costs $4 - $12 and takes 6h 16m.
The fastest way to get from Downey to Morongo Casino, Resort & Spa is to drive which takes 1h 33m and costs $15 - $23.
No, there is no direct bus from Downey station to Morongo Casino, Resort & Spa. However, there are services departing from C Line Station and arriving at Cabazon Amtrak Bus Stop via Fullerton Amtrak Station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 58m.
The distance between Downey and Morongo Casino, Resort & Spa is 85 miles. The road distance is 84.5 miles.
The best way to get from Downey to Morongo Casino, Resort & Spa without a car is to bus which takes 3h 58m and costs $30 - $45.
It takes approximately 3h 58m to get from Downey to Morongo Casino, Resort & Spa, including transfers.
Downey to Morongo Casino, Resort & Spa bus services, operated by Amtrak, depart from Fullerton Amtrak Station.
Downey to Morongo Casino, Resort & Spa bus services, operated by Amtrak, arrive at Cabazon Amtrak Bus Stop station.
Yes, the driving distance between Downey to Morongo Casino, Resort & Spa is 84 miles. It takes approximately 1h 33m to drive from Downey to Morongo Casino, Resort & Spa.
